Must see: Arthur Kaliyev nets his first ever goal as a member of the New York Rangers
Very exciting night for New York Rangers newly acquired forward Arthur Kaliyev as he scores his first goal as a member of the New York Rangers organization on Thursday night against the Utah Hockey Club.
Arthur Kaliyev capitalized on a rebound from
Filip Chytil's shot, ultimately finding the back of the net for his very first goal as a member of the New York Ranger.
Arthur Kaliyev's first Rangers goal!
The New York Rangers recently claimed Kaliyev off waivers on January 6th, after the Los Angeles Kings decided to part ways with the young forward.
The 23-year old forward was originally selected 33rd overall by the Kings in the 2nd round of the 2019 NHL Draft, and was thought to be one of the Kings top prospects.
Unfortunately things didn't play out that way as he struggled to earn a spot and produce consistently in the lineup, ultimately leaving him to be placed on waivers and joining the New York Rangers. Marking tonight's game his 4th appearance with the Rangers as well.
